Before You Go

Complete online training before arrival

Finish the Discover Scuba Diver eLearning and medical waiver immediately after booking so you’re cleared to dive and the operator can confirm your spot.

No flying the same day

Plan your flight schedule—flying within 18 hours of scuba is unsafe and not permitted after this activity.

Bring reef-safe sunscreen and a dry change of clothes

Protect reefs with mineral-based sunscreen and have clothing ready for the drive back to town.

Provide accurate height/weight/shoe size

Operators need your measurements to fit equipment correctly—especially boot size for fins—so send these when requested.

Conservation Note

Reef health is fragile—use reef-safe sunscreen, avoid touching coral, and follow guide instructions to minimize contact and anchor damage.

Lahaina was a 19th-century whaling port and later a center for sugar and pineapple; modern dive culture grew as the town shifted to tourism and ocean recreation.

Common Questions

Do I need prior scuba certification?

No—this introductory lesson is for non-certified divers; you must complete the eLearning and medical waiver first.

How long is the dive session?

The total activity time is approximately 135 minutes, including briefing, gearing up, the in-water experience, and return.

Can I fly the same day after diving?

No—you must wait at least 18 hours after diving before flying or taking helicopter tours to avoid decompression risk.

What is the group size?

Groups are limited to a maximum of four participants for focused instruction and safety.

Are children allowed?

Minimum age is 12; children must demonstrate basic swimming skills and be comfortable in the ocean.

What should I tell the operator before arrival?

Provide full names, age, height, weight, and US men’s shoe size so equipment can be prepared and fitted correctly.
